[发明专利]一种消息转发方法、系统、电子设备及存储介质有效
申请号: | 202111521859.3 | 申请日: | 2021-12-13 |
公开(公告)号: | CN114157598B | 公开(公告)日: | 2023-04-07 |
发明(设计)人: | 潘超 | 申请(专利权)人: | 百果园技术(新加坡)有限公司 |
主分类号: | H04L45/247 | 分类号: | H04L45/247;H04L45/28;H04L47/31;H04L69/22 |
代理公司: | 北京泽方誉航专利代理事务所(普通合伙) 11884 | 代理人: | 徐濛 |
地址: | 巴西班让路枫树*** | 国省代码: | 暂无信息 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 一种 消息 转发 方法 系统 电子设备 存储 介质 | ||
1.一种消息转发方法,其特征在于,包括:
接收上级节点发送的第一消息,使用设定协议封装所述第一消息,所述设定协议用于与各个下级节点进行通信,以指示对应下级节点对所述第一消息进行回包;
根据所述第一消息包含的路由字段,将所述第一消息转发至对应的目标下级节点;
接收所述目标下级节点根据所述第一消息回包的第二消息,使用所述设定协议解封装所述第二消息,将所述第二消息转发至所述上级节点,并根据所述第二消息执行所述目标下级节点的流量调度业务。
2.根据权利要求1所述的消息转发方法,其特征在于,所述根据所述第一消息包含的路由字段,将所述第一消息转发至对应的目标下级节点,包括:
确定所述第一消息包含的路由字段;
根据所述路由字段所处的字段范围将所述第一消息转发至对应的目标下级节点,所述目标下级节点预先配置对应的所述字段范围,以指示所述目标下级节点负责处理所述字段范围内的所述第一消息。
3.根据权利要求2所述的消息转发方法,其特征在于,所述根据所述第二消息执行所述目标下级节点的流量调度业务,包括:
基于所述第二消息确定所述目标下级节点过载,缩小所述目标下级节点对应的所述字段范围,将所述字段范围中指定分段的所述路由字段调配至其余下级节点。
4.根据权利要求2所述的消息转发方法,其特征在于,所述根据所述第二消息执行所述目标下级节点的流量调度业务,还包括:
基于所述第二消息确定所述目标下级节点故障,将与所述目标下级节点对应的所述字段范围的所述第一消息调配至其余下级节点,以指示其余下级节点处理所述字段范围内的所述第一消息。
5.根据权利要求3所述的消息转发方法,其特征在于,将所述目标下级节点对应的所述字段范围调配至其余下级节点,包括:
提取所述第一消息中包含的备用路由信息,基于所述备用路由信息从其余下级节点中确定所述第一消息的备用路由节点,将所述第一消息发送至所述备用路由节点。
6.根据权利要求2所述的消息转发方法,其特征在于,所述根据所述第二消息执行所述目标下级节点的流量调度业务,还包括:
基于所述第二消息确定所述目标下级节点的计算资源状态,并根据所述计算资源状态扩展所述目标下级节点对应的所述字段范围。
7.根据权利要求2所述的消息转发方法,其特征在于,在将所述第一消息转发至对应的目标下级节点之后,还包括:
在确定所述第二消息接收超时的情况下,执行所述目标下级节点的流量调度业务或者重发所述第一消息。
8.一种消息转发系统,其特征在于,包括:
封装模块,用于接收上级节点发送的第一消息,使用设定协议封装所述第一消息,所述设定协议用于与各个下级节点进行通信,以指示对应下级节点对所述第一消息进行回包;
转发模块,用于根据所述第一消息包含的路由字段,将所述第一消息转发至对应的目标下级节点;
接收模块,用于接收所述目标下级节点根据所述第一消息回包的第二消息,使用所述设定协议解封装所述第二消息,将所述第二消息转发至所述上级节点,并根据所述第二消息执行所述目标下级节点的流量调度业务。
9.一种电子设备,其特征在于,包括:
存储器以及一个或多个处理器;
所述存储器,用于存储一个或多个程序;
当所述一个或多个程序被所述一个或多个处理器执行,使得所述一个或多个处理器实现如权利要求1-7任一所述的消息转发方法。
10.一种包含计算机可执行指令的存储介质,其特征在于,所述计算机可执行指令在由计算机处理器执行时用于执行如权利要求1-7任一所述的消息转发方法。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于百果园技术(新加坡)有限公司,未经百果园技术(新加坡)有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/202111521859.3/1.html,转载请声明来源钻瓜专利网。